331d91a1a366fcfd3cdb4a39c0f249a0b0aea76d59944656c10d5974bd1a6d9b

1421092 (195613 blocks ago)

⏴ Block 1421091 (11d8bb1b...8bd) | Block 1421093 ⏵ | Latest block ⏭

Metadata

9/30/23, 9:46 AM UTC (271d 16:27:03 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details